While traveling to Yellowstone National Park, I took this scenic byway out of Ashton, Idaho. I stopped first at the Upper Falls and was very impressed, then went to the lower falls, which were nice, but you needed a telephoto lens to capture them.
As I was taking a picture, a gentleman suggested I return to the upper falls to see the rainbow. It only pops out between 9 and noon, which makes sense as the canyon walls are high. So I returned to witness this fantastic site and was fortunate to capture this photo.
